Didier Pittet is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Infectious Diseases and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Didier Pittet has authored 4 papers receiving a total of 903 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 2 papers in Infectious Diseases and 1 paper in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Didier Pittet’s work include Infection Control and Ventilation (3 papers), Infection Control in Healthcare (2 papers) and Nosocomial Infections in ICU (1 paper). Didier Pittet is often cited by papers focused on Infection Control and Ventilation (3 papers), Infection Control in Healthcare (2 papers) and Nosocomial Infections in ICU (1 paper). Didier Pittet coll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land and United States. Didier Pittet's co-authors include Jonas Marschall, Andreas F. Widmer, Carlo Balmelli, Nicolas Troillet, Stephan Harbarth, Matthias Schlegel, Rami Sommerstein, Christoph Andreas Fux, Stephan Harbarth and Marie‐Christine Eisenring and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Emerging infectious diseases and Infection Control and Hospital Epidemiology.
